As per , the former Liverpool captain has been offered to Bundesliga sides Bayern Munich and Bayer Leverkusen, after it was reported that the player wants to leave Al-Ettifaq, just six months after joining them for £13 million from the Reds.

The England midfielder's start to life in the Middles East has not gone to plan as his club has won just six out of their 19 league clashes and currently find themselves eighth in the table. The 33-year-old has also struggled to adjust to the humid weather of Saudi Arabia which has prompted him to take the drastic decision.

If the player decides to turn his back on Al-Ettifaq, the move could cost him around £7 million ($9m). He currently earns £700,000-per-week tax-free in Saudi Arabia but the tax-free element only kicks in if he sees out the first two years of his contract.

As of now, the Saudi club is not willing to sell their marquee player in the January transfer as they are looking to turn things around once the winter break is over. The player too has not yet handed an official transfer request to the Steven Gerrard-managed side.
